Where is the Jungs family from?

You can see how Jungs families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Jungs family name was found in the USA between 1880 and 1920. The most Jungs families were found in USA in 1920. In 1880 there was 1 Jungs family living in Illinois. This was 100% of all the recorded Jungs's in USA. Illinois had the highest population of Jungs families in 1880.
